Honduras - Forest Area
Since 2014, Honduras Forest Area was down by 0.3points year on year. At 57.07 Percent of Land Area in 2019, the country was number 34 comparing other countries in Forest Area. Honduras is overtaken by Samoa, which was ranked number 33 at 57.34 Percent of Land Area and is followed by Panama with 57.02 Percent of Land Area. Suriname lead the ranking with 97.54 Percent of Land Area in 2019, a fall of 0points compared to 2018. Guyana, Gabon and Solomon Islands resp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ta recorded the best 5 years average growth at +5.4points per year, while Oman was the worst growing country at -4.4points per year.
